# ApeCoin

The ApeCoin app allows you to accept $APE as a payment method for your NFTs. For a limited time, enjoy 0% fees on all ApeCoin revenue.

### Pre-requisite

* Deployed Ethereum Contract using NiftytKit
* Sales must be paused or not yet started.

{% hint style="info" %}
**ApeCoin payments are not available in Polygon, Arbitrum, or Optimism projects**
{% endhint %}

### Installing ApeCoin

[Go to your collection](https://app.niftykit.com/dashboard?tab=collections), then navigate to the  **\[APPS]** tab and click on **\[Add]** as shown below.

<figure><img src="/files/2MlI1wcuHv0wYJESAPGI" alt=""><figcaption><p>ApeCoin App</p></figcaption></figure>

Select the collection you want to add the ApeCoin App to.

<figure><img src="/files/2xx1B86bbniIy0qjzx40" alt=""><figcaption><p>Select NiftyKit Eth Drop Collection</p></figcaption></figure>

{% hint style="info" %}
Be sure to restart any active sale after installing or uninstalling the ApeCoin App for it to take effect.
{% endhint %}
